Output 3388eb8d043186f967d99dd9779fcede269f91ecd07bfaaf6ea3c2be7afff7cb:57

value
80028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58024a583379df720c1ec96ecc0b6b18ba1dad25 OP_EQUAL
address
39iN8ZjZSjqMvMf2nAykDaKCFXdFmWgpC6
transaction
3388eb8d043186f967d99dd9779fcede269f91ecd07bfaaf6ea3c2be7afff7cb
confirmations
154079
spent
true